First Edition of a long discontinued book " The Autobiography of Adam Thomson - HIGH RISK - The Politics of the Air ". Sir Adam Thomson was the Chairman of British Caledonian Airways . He flew with the RAF in World War II and left with just a few pounds in his de-mob suit. This book details how he brought British Caledonian Airways to success and then how he lost control to British Airways in the late eighties after many boardroom battles with Lord King. Published 24 years ago by Sidgwick and Jackson the book has 590 pages and the centre of the book has several pages of fascinating photographs of his early years and later the British Caledonian era with board meetings, meeting Royals and dignitaries and including the air hostesses in the fabulous tartan uniform!
